FD-5 English Function F2 The function F2 allows an accessory connected to the output X6, with a maximum current consumption of 500 mA, to be switched on or off. Function F4 If the configuration variable CV 56 is programmed accordingly, the function F4 allows an optional accessory, connected to the output X9, to be switched on or off.
English FD-5 Technical specifications Data format Supply voltage 12-24 Volt digital voltage Current consumption (without connected loads) ca. 10 mA Max. current per function output 500 mA Max. total current 1.500 mA Protected to IP 00 Ambient temperature in use 0 - + 60°...

FD-5 English Caution: The return conductor for all functions (point X1) must under no circumstances be connected to locomotive resp. carriage ground. Possible short circuit! The decoder will be damaged in operation. Caution: If you connect the loads to the return conductor for all functions (point X1), the loads must be insulated.

FD-5 English § Parts are getting too hot and/or start to smoke. Disconnect the module from the mains immediately! Possible cause: Short circuit. The decoder is connected to locomotive or carriage ground. à Check the connections. A short circuit can result in irreparable damage.
